Output 5d3c680ebcc3a9f52cdb43cf339950781b47140ebf944830ac9be1af6c21f6e4:1

value
148181407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8def2eeb0949593476e79e4cab92033cef41542 OP_EQUAL
address
3L189g6CXTpNZD8ryAbQKopKGhejq9Bv3q
transaction
5d3c680ebcc3a9f52cdb43cf339950781b47140ebf944830ac9be1af6c21f6e4
confirmations
127476
spent
true